European Locations For IT Infrastructure.

With weariness about data laws in the U.S. growing among enterprises, many are opting to host their data in European countries. According to a survey by ResearchNow, commissioned by Peer1 Hosting, the data sovereignty issue is so important that 70% of U.S. businesses would give up some level of performance to ensure they have control over their data. In light of the new focus on storing data outside the U.S., Interxion, a leading provider of cloud and carrier-neutral colocation data center services in Europe, has released an infographic to help companies navigate the process of hosting their infrastructure in a particular European nation. The infographic details various regions’ strengths: for instance, France is a leading point for international telecoms backbones, while Germany is the largest economy in Europe and is home to Frankfurt, one of the best-connected cities globally and a gateway into Eastern Europe and the Far East.
